Top 10 Reasons to Adopt a Cat |
 |
10. No backyard or nearby park? No Problem!
Cats do not need a large space to be comfortable. They are an ideal pet for studio, apartment and small home dwellers. |
 |
5. Overnight business trip? No kennel for me. I’ll stay home.
Cats are independent creatures who can be left alone overnight with plenty of food, water and a clean litter box. We’ll play together when you get home. A present is always appreciated. |
 |
9. Who needs to go for a walk? Not me!
Cats do not need to be taken for daily walks in the cold, snow, rain, heat or humidity. They exercise themselves as they play. Cats should be inside-only cats. |
 |
4. Good things come in small packages.
Cats are naturally small so they have small accessories: small carriers, small toys, small bowls, small collars and small bags of Purina ® cat food. If you don’t overfeed a cat, it will remain small too! |
 |
8. I’m already housetrained!
Mother cats teach their kittens to use a litter box at an early age. You won’t need newspapers and training pads throughout your home—only a tidy litter box. |
 |
3. Neat freak? Me too!
Cats like to keep themselves very clean and tidy. Short-haired cats require little grooming. |
 |
7. Play time anyone?
All cats like to play, even if they are quite old. They like to play with toys, balls of string, people and other cats. |
 |
2. Friends , Friends, Friends
Most cats make friends easily with adults and children. They also benefit from having a feline friend who can help burn off extra energy, curb loneliness during absences and act as pillows for one another. |
 |
6. Stressful job? Long commute? I’ll help you unwind!
Most cats like to be held and petted which can help relieve tension. When I start to purr, you’ll know we are both relaxed. I’m also a good listener and I’ll never tell anyone what you said about your boss. |
 |
